Talo Samila Beach is a once-lost land that has transformed into an emerging travel destination. For over 20 years, relentless waves eroded hundreds of rai of the villagers' land, submerging it beneath the sea. However, in recent years, the construction of concrete barriers against coastal erosion has led to the gradual emergence of this stunning white sand beach. Stretching along the Gulf of Thailand coastline for approximately 1 kilometer, it is located within Moo 1-3 of Laem Pho sub-district. Today, Talo Samila Beach has become an attractive new tourist spot, sparking trade and generating income for the local community. Numerous resorts, guesthouses, and restaurants now cater to visitors. Tourists can enjoy activities such as barbecuing, banana boat rides, and boat tours through mangrove forests. Additionally, Talo Samila Beach offers breathtaking views of both sunrises in the morning and sunsets in the evening, making it a perfect destination for nature enthusiasts.
